Synopsis: Four years prior to California's 2003 gubernatorial recall, the Golden State played host to another raucous political race that captured the public imagination. In San Francisco's 1999 mayoral runoff, incumbent Mayor Willie Brown faced opposition from 12 different candidates in his second-term reelection bid--but none more daunting than openly-gay standup comedian Tom Ammiano, who staged a historic grassroots write-in campaign that incited a dramatic showdown of epic proportion. Director Emily Morse documents the political mudslinging, behind-the-scenes brawls, and media-circus frenzy of the election in her sharp-witted feature SEE HOW THEY RUN, a comic expose of the often scandalous world of campaign politics. Features guest appearances by Bill Maher, Sean Penn, Arianna Huffington, Reverend Jesse Jackson, U.S. Senator Dianne Feinstein, and many more. [More]
